]> git.ipfire.org Git - thirdparty/libvirt.git/commit
conf: add support for discard_granularity
authorKristina Hanicova <khanicov@redhat.com>
Fri, 25 Aug 2023 12:50:31 +0000 (14:50 +0200)
committerPeter Krempa <pkrempa@redhat.com>
Fri, 25 Aug 2023 13:05:13 +0000 (15:05 +0200)
commit96d8ee2cffeb1a2ab12e5ae5a3a933da7c999668
tree255db0862dd60f8b882f0e9d4709cdda30b9c9d4
parentc3934b2b6b1a9d572cbf5b2685ba760eb8dfe402
conf: add support for discard_granularity

This introduces the ability to set the discard granularity option
for a disk.  It defines the smallest amount of data that can be
discarded in a single operation (useful for managing and
optimizing storage).

However, most hypervisors automatically set the proper discard
granularity and users usually do not need to change the default
setting.

Signed-off-by: Kristina Hanicova <khanicov@redhat.com>
Reviewed-by: Peter Krempa <pkrempa@redhat.com>
docs/formatdomain.rst
src/conf/domain_conf.c
src/conf/domain_conf.h
src/conf/domain_validate.c
src/conf/schemas/domaincommon.rng
src/qemu/qemu_domain.c
src/vz/vz_utils.c